PMKIND

Dependencies:   rohm-rpr0521 rohm-sensor-hal Servo TextLCD

Committer:
pavledjo
Date:
Sun Jun 27 17:38:31 2021 +0000
Revision:
1:7b52bdcdac4e
Parent:
0:51001d8fdeff
PMK_m1;

Who changed what in which revision?

UserRevisionLine numberNew contents of line
emilija 0:51001d8fdeff 1
emilija 0:51001d8fdeff 2 class ColorSensor{
emilija 0:51001d8fdeff 3 public:
emilija 0:51001d8fdeff 4 ColorSensor(PinName ss0, PinName ss1, PinName ss2, PinName ss3, PinName sout);
emilija 0:51001d8fdeff 5 DigitalOut s0;
emilija 0:51001d8fdeff 6 DigitalOut s1;
emilija 0:51001d8fdeff 7 DigitalOut s2;
emilija 0:51001d8fdeff 8 DigitalOut s3;
emilija 0:51001d8fdeff 9 InterruptIn _out;
emilija 0:51001d8fdeff 10 Ticker ts;
emilija 0:51001d8fdeff 11 void poll();
emilija 0:51001d8fdeff 12 int interrupted;
emilija 0:51001d8fdeff 13 int countR;
emilija 0:51001d8fdeff 14 int countG;
emilija 0:51001d8fdeff 15 int countB;
emilija 0:51001d8fdeff 16 int counter;
emilija 0:51001d8fdeff 17 int flag;
emilija 0:51001d8fdeff 18 int getRed();
emilija 0:51001d8fdeff 19 int getGreen();
emilija 0:51001d8fdeff 20 int getBlue();
emilija 0:51001d8fdeff 21 void getReading();
emilija 0:51001d8fdeff 22 void incCount();
emilija 0:51001d8fdeff 23
emilija 0:51001d8fdeff 24 private:
emilija 0:51001d8fdeff 25
emilija 0:51001d8fdeff 26
emilija 0:51001d8fdeff 27 protected:
emilija 0:51001d8fdeff 28
emilija 0:51001d8fdeff 29
emilija 0:51001d8fdeff 30 };